@Bruins77 

In our family, three of us have a $13, a $19 and a $29 plan. The only plans available for each of us for changing are all more expensive than our existing plan.  For us, PM will not let us downgrade to a cheaper plan. For the $13 plan, available plans are $19 and up.  For the $19 plan, available plans are $23 and up. For the $29 plan, available plans are $30 and up. YMMV.

@Bruins77 

Public mobile has switched to personalized plan offers for existing customers.  Some of the more attractive plans are only for new activations.  Most of the personalized plan offers are "upgrades" to higher price plans with more data.  Occasional downgrade plans are offered (ie. cheaper plans).  Each existing customer will have different plan offers.  

You can check your account and to see what plans are available.
